Love And Death In The Eternal City
When one thinks of Rome, several things come to mind - breathtaking architecture, delicious cuisine, rich history, and a romantic ambiance like no other. It is a city that has witnessed both love and death throughout centuries, with stories passed down for generations. The eternal city has seen empires rise and fall, poets and artists finding inspiration in its streets, and lovers entwining their lives while surrounded by unparalleled beauty.
Rome, also known as "The Eternal City," holds a sense of timelessness that lures people from all over the world. Its ancient ruins, such as the Colosseum and the Roman Forum, stand as a reminder of its glorious past. Walking through the cobblestone streets, one can't help but feel the presence of history, as if the walls themselves are whispering tales of love and tragedy.

Love stories have bloomed and thrived in Rome since ancient times. From the legend of Romulus and Remus, the founding myth of Rome, to the passionate affair between Mark Antony and Cleopatra, the city has been a backdrop for countless epic romances. The Trevi Fountain, with its stunning Baroque artwork, has become a symbol of romantic love, with couples tossing coins over their shoulders to ensure everlasting love.
The art and literature that have emerged from Rome also reflect the theme of amor and mortality. The masterpieces of Italian Renaissance painters, like Michelangelo and Raphael, depict love and death intertwined in their works. The Sistine Chapel, with its stunning frescoes, showcases the beauty and vulnerability of human existence, reminding us of the transient nature of life.
But Rome is not just about love; it is a city that has also confronted death throughout history. The Catacombs of Rome, ancient underground burial sites, are a haunting reminder of the mortality of human beings. These underground passageways hold the remains of early Christians and offer a glimpse into a different era. Exploring them reveals the fragility of life and the interconnectedness of love and death.
As dusk descends upon the city, the vibrant streets and piazzas transform into a melancholic setting, resonating with tales of love and loss. The Spanish Steps, once a gathering place for artists and poets, have witnessed countless farewells and longing glances. The city's churches, adorned with stunning sculptures and haunting frescoes, offer solace to those seeking refuge from the inevitable fate of mortality.
Furthermore, Rome's daily life is infused with passionate emotions. The Italian people are known for their expressive and passionate nature, openly displaying affection towards their loved ones. It is a city where love is celebrated, and life is cherished, reminding us to live fully and embrace every moment.
Rome is a city that has woven together the beauty of love and the inevitability of death. It allows us to witness the fragile nature of human existence and serves as a reminder to treasure the moments we have with loved ones. Whether you stroll hand in hand through the picturesque streets, admire the breathtaking art, or dine at a cozy trattoria, the eternal city enthralls the senses and evokes emotions in a way that few other places can.
In , Love And Death In The Eternal City encapsulates the intertwining themes that have shaped Rome's identity throughout history. It is a city where the past merges with the present, where every corner holds stories of love and loss. Rome invites us to reflect on our mortality, celebrate love, and embrace the beauty of life. It is a place to fall in love with both a person and a city - a timeless experience that leaves an indelible mark on the soul.

From Italy's popular author Corrado Augias comes the most intriguing exploration of Rome ever to be published. In the mold of his earlier histories of Paris, New York, and London, Augias moves perceptively through twenty-seven centuries of Roman life, shedding new light on a cast of famous, and infamous, historical figures and uncovering secrets and conspiracies that have shaped the city without our ever knowing it. From Rome's origins as Romulus's stomping ground to the dark atmosphere of the Middle Ages; from Caesar's unscrupulousness to Caravaggio's lurid genius; from the notorious Lucrezia Borgia to the seductive Anna Fallarino, the marchioness at the center of one of Rome's most heinous crimes of the post-war period, Augias creates a sweeping account of the passions that have shaped this complex city: at once both a metropolis and a village, where all human sentiment-bravery and cowardice, industriousness and sloth, enterprise and laxity-find their interpreters and stage. If the history of humankind is all passion and uproar, then, as the author notes, "for centuries Rome has been the mirror of this history, reflecting with excruciating accuracy every detail, even those that might cause you to avert your gaze."
